This guide is written for would-be hosting entrepreneurs choosing between owning customers and referring them. If that's you, the decision has a right answer — it just isn't the one the comparison-table industry is paid to give you.

Affiliate bounties pay once per referral while resold hosting margins recur monthly — over a multi-year customer lifetime, ownership out-earns referral by multiples, in exchange for doing the work. Keep that in view and most of the noise in this market resolves into signal.

What to measure before you buy

Judge every candidate against these, in order:

Who owns the customer relationship and its lifetime value.

Revenue shape: recurring margin versus one-off bounties.

Responsibility load — support obligations against referral simplicity.

Brand equity: whether the work builds your asset or the host's.

The due-diligence checklist

Any host worth choosing survives verification: check the renewal price is printed (not footnoted), ask support a real question at an odd hour and judge the answer, read the refund policy for carve-outs, and search the company's registration — a real business has a paper trail.

Then let usage decide: a fortnight of real use inside the money-back window tells you more than every review site combined — and switching costs you nothing but the time to open a migration ticket.

How much work is reselling compared to referring?

Real work — first-line support, billing, client management — offset by tooling (WHM, WHMCS) and our infrastructure team behind you. Referral is passive; reselling is a business precisely because it isn't.

Can I do both?

Sensibly, yes — many resellers affiliate for products they don't stock while reselling their core. The discipline is honesty about which relationship each customer is in.

Is SSL really included at no cost?

On every plan, with no exceptions — certificates are issued automatically when your domain points to us and renew themselves before expiry. The encryption is identical to paid DV certificates; paid tiers exist only for wildcard convenience or organisation-level validation.
